Primary
The nearest Primary school to the Manse is
Long Row Primary School, which is a co-educational, county day
school for children aged 4+ to 11+ years. The governors of
Long Row Primary are committed to keeping class sizes as small
as possible. On average there are about 30 pupils in each
class. With the exception of the Reception children, pupils
are grouped in classes of mixed ability, sex and age. Most
children transfer to Belper School in the September following
their 11th birthday.
Pottery Primary School is a community
school for pupils of 4 – 11 years. The maximum number of new
entrants to be admitted in the 4+ age group in the school year
is 60.
There is also a C of E and a Catholic
school within Belper as well as further schools in the
vicinity.
Secondary
Belper School is an 11-18 comprehensive
school for all children within the Belper area. Since 1994 the
school has been a Technology College with extensive P.C.
provisions for its students.
The school was opened in 1973 and is set
within its own grounds and extensive playing fields on the
edge of the rural town of Belper. They currently have around
1130 students on roll, including a Sixth Form of about 150.
